1. Exceptional Safety & Flight Stability
Safety is the foundation of every job we deliver. Our drones include enterprise-grade flight controllers, integrated RTK modules for centimeter-level positioning, multi-directional obstacle-avoidance radar, and intelligent low-battery return-to-home logic. Together these systems make the window washing drone and drone pressure washer highly reliable in complex urban and industrial environments, reducing the need for risky rope access or scaffold-based cleaning.
2. Long Endurance — Fewer Battery Swaps, Higher Output
Our aircraft delivers 40–50 minutes of flight time under typical operational loads. That extended endurance means crews spend more time cleaning and less time swapping batteries or repositioning equipment. For large façades, rooftops, or solar arrays, longer single-flight coverage translates directly into improved site throughput and lower labor costs per square meter.

3. Modular Design — One Drone, Many Jobs
Cost-effectiveness comes from versatility. By swapping purpose-built cleaning modules, the same drone can function as a drone window washer, a pressure washing drone for exterior walls, a solar panel cleaning drone for photovoltaic arrays, or a roof cleaning drone for low-angle surface work. This modular approach reduces capital expenditure and shortens payback periods for operators who serve multiple verticals.
4. Simple, Automated Operation
Usability is a priority. Our software supports pre-planned flight paths and automated cleaning runs-operators can map façades or panel arrays, save routes, and let the drone execute the mission autonomously. Automated flight planning cuts operator workload, ensures consistent coverage, and reduces human error during drone cleaning windows or large-scale jobs.
